Estou utilizando o vb6 com access 2000 e não estou conseguindo carregar dados em um datagrid via código, ele fica em branco, e não aparece nem o titulo dos campos nas colunas.
Desde já agradeço, quem poder me dar uma dica para o problema.
Option Explicit
Dim rs As New ADODB.Recordset
Dim rs2 As New ADODB.Recordset
Private Sub cboFuncionario_Click()
rs.Find "NomeFuncionario ='" & cboFuncionario.Text & "'", , adSearchForward, 1
Set rs2 = New ADODB.Recordset
rs2.Open "SELECT * FROM Atraso WHERE CodFuncionario = " & rs!CodFuncionario & " ORDER BY DataAtraso", cn, adOpenKeyset, adLockOptimistic
Set datAtraso.DataSource = rs
datAtraso.Refresh
End Sub
Private Sub Form_Load()
Me.Left = (frmFicabos.ScaleWidth - Me.Width) / 2 'Centralizará o formulário porque este é um formulário mdi child
Me.Top = (frmFicabos.ScaleHeight - Me.Height) / 2
Set rs = New ADODB.Recordset
rs.Open "SELECT CodFuncionario, NomeFuncionario FROM FuncionarioPessoal ORDER BY NomeFuncionario", cn, adOpenKeyset, adLockOptimistic
PreencheCboFuncionario
cboFuncionario.ListIndex = 0
End Sub
Private Sub PreencheCboFuncionario()
Dim i As Integer
cboFuncionario.Clear
For i = 1 To rs.RecordCount
rs.AbsolutePosition = i
cboFuncionario.AddItem rs!NomeFuncionario
Next
End Sub
Editado por kuroi Ponha os códigos dentro da tag CODE
Pergunta
MarcioPro
Olá a todos este é meu primeiro post aqui.
Estou utilizando o vb6 com access 2000 e não estou conseguindo carregar dados em um datagrid via código, ele fica em branco, e não aparece nem o titulo dos campos nas colunas.
Desde já agradeço, quem poder me dar uma dica para o problema.
Editado por kuroiPonha os códigos dentro da tag CODE
Link para o comentário
Compartilhar em outros sites
2 respostass a esta questão
Posts Recomendados
Participe da discussão
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.